
Stephanie Gonyeau: VST Judge
Although Stephanie Gonyeau has owned Basset Hounds since 1966, it took until 1991 for her to become interested in tracking. At the Nationals that year in New Jersey, Stephanie’s Oxboros Boughs of Holly earned her T.D. and Stephanie was hooked on the sport of tracking.
Since that first Basset TD, Stephanie’s Bassets (and one Golden Retriever) have passed a total of 15 tracking tests and three tracking dog excellent tests. During this time, Stephanie became more fascinated by tracking and started assisting in training tracking classes for local kennel and tracking clubs. She soon became a full trainer.
Eventually, Stephanie was encouraged to apply for judging status. She is currently approved to judge Tracking Dog, Tracking Dog Excellent, Tracking Dog Urban and Variable Surface Tracking.
